Transaction 28baa8da792730093077209c944138edbfc39b834d95671ff4f3516d09a053d9

2 Input
2 Outputs
  • 28baa8da792730093077209c944138edbfc39b834d95671ff4f3516d09a053d9:0
  • value  2100000000
    address  16Tja1And82s2eE1WLpNeRcq7WucJJ6t2A
  • 28baa8da792730093077209c944138edbfc39b834d95671ff4f3516d09a053d9:1
  • value  3345951
    address  13oeFhVWhyTjbQeRqMe4Vd5x7VmUbW6T9m